About this position
TNO at Holst Centre works with a range of pre-pilot to pilot level battery production technologies in the fast-growing domain of Next-Generation Energy Storage. The aim is to employ the unique thin-film and innovative/additive manufacturing technologies background of Holst Centre to contribute to the development and (cheaper) production of next generation battery technologies such as high-voltage lithium (sodium) metal batteries and solid-state-batteries. To this end, TNO at Holst Centre works closely with the local and international ecosystem of battery and battery component producers. The aim of the program is to accelerate the much-needed energy transition while concurrently increasing the earning power of (high-tech) companies active in this domain. In order to translate new process technologies such as dry coating into tangible battery concepts, we are looking for a battery engineer as an addition to our battery team.
What will be your role?
You will join the Thin-Film Electronics team to develop and realize the department’s Next-Generation Battery Technology program, leveraging Holst Centre’s strengths in thin-film and innovative/additive manufacturing technologies background. Your daily activities will be varied since you will join a multidisciplinary team that executes multiple programs and projects with partners from academia and industry in parallel. Your technical tasks will include executing carefully designed experiments to achieve cheaper and more sustainable next generation battery manufacturing through dry-coating. This will involve designing, setting up and upkeeping laboratory equipment; assembling single- and multi-layered pouch cells to demonstrate performance of innovative battery components; and, developing battery cell formation protocols to reduce cell conditioning costs.
- Design and optimize laboratory-scale processes for solvent-free electrode coating using a range of binder materials, including PTFE and F-free binders.
- Design (with the program’s battery scientists) and execute experiments to contribute to other program goals.
- Designing, installing and up-keeping laboratory equipment.
- Assembling coin and single- & multi-layered pouch cells.
- Performing physico-chemical (EDX) & morphological (using SEM) & electrochemical measurements (galvanostatic cycling, EIS, CV).
- Performing mechanical testing, including tensile strength and peel strength measurements, to evaluate structural integrity and current collector adhesion.
- Compiling reports and presenting the work in critical manner to internal and external stakeholders.
- Contributing to IP.
